Lemmy
Decentralized Reddit. Communities without tracking or opaque sorting algorithms.
Description
Lemmy works like Reddit but on the Fediverse. Each instance hosts communities, and all instances communicate with each other. No advertising, no opaque algorithm. Sorting is transparent and data isn't monetized.
Strengths
- Decentralized and federated (Fediverse)
- No ads or monetized data
- Active communities on tech, Linux, privacy
- Open source, active development
Limitations
- Fewer communities than Reddit
- Mobile apps less polished than Reddit app
Recommended for
- Leaving Reddit for a decentralized forum
- Tech, Linux, privacy communities
Compared to alternatives
Lemmy is the Fediverse's Reddit (forums and communities). Mastodon is for microblogging. Both are decentralized and interoperable.
